My right airpod doesn't work, second time that it happened to me

I bought my airpods and then while I had apple care I request a replacement because right airpod stoped working, now again the right airpod doesn't work for not reason. I don't have the coverage, what can I do?

If there's no sound in one AirPod
1. Make sure that your charging case is fully charged.
2. Place both AirPods in your charging case and let them charge for 30 seconds.
3. Open the charging case near your iPhone or iPad.
4. Check the charge status on your iPhone or iPad to make sure that each AirPod is charging .
5. Put both AirPods in your ears.
6. Play audio to test both AirPods.
7. If an AirPod still isn't working, reset your AirPods or contact Apple Support.


If still having issues after going through the steps above, we'd also recommend testing the issue with your AirPods connected to another device as well. This can help confirm if there's an issue with the AirPods, or maybe the device that they're paired with.


If the issue is present on multiple devices, then the next best option would be to reach out to Apple Support for available service/replacement options in your region. You can reach out to Apple Support directly from this link here: Get Support


If your AirPods are no longer covered under AppleCare, you can find more details on service and pricing here: AirPods Repair & Service - Apple Support
